EDITORS COMMENTS
The engraving captures a pivotal moment in history - the return of the royal family to Paris after their failed attempt to escape to Varennes in 1791. The image depicts a scene filled with tension and uncertainty. As they travel along the road, a military escort surrounds the carriage, emphasizing their status as prisoners. In the foreground, we see Queen Marie Antoinette of Austria sitting inside the carriage, her face reflecting both exhaustion and apprehension. Beside her is King Louis XVI, wearing his military uniform, symbolizing his diminished authority. Their children are also present, their innocent faces contrasting starkly with the weight of events unfolding around them. The composition highlights not only the royal family's journey but also provides glimpses into French society at that time. The onlookers lining the streets represent a diverse cross-section of population - some curious or sympathetic while others may be resentful or angry towards their monarchs. This engraving serves as a poignant reminder of how quickly fortunes can change during times of revolution and upheaval. It encapsulates an era when monarchy was being challenged by revolutionary ideals and ultimately led to significant changes in France's political landscape.
